Output d2391562a913e9c30a9791c9494be3a0b223fb3c902609fee4aeacdae7f3ab89:42

value
10370032
script pubkey
OP_0 OP_PUSHBYTES_20 29809086bd75b5f29c81b659c45e96977015fa4f
address
bc1q9xqfpp4awk6l98ypkevugh5kjacpt7j0887nkj
transaction
d2391562a913e9c30a9791c9494be3a0b223fb3c902609fee4aeacdae7f3ab89